Judy Kaye

Summary

Judy Kaye is a human[1]. Her place of birth was Phoenix[2]. She was born on October 11, 1948[3]. She worked as an actor[4], singer[5], and television actor[6]. She ranks in the top 0.72%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(258 views/month, #7,200 of 1,000,298).[7]
